Katherine McKenzie 1574–1593 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 11 JAN 1574

Birth Location: Kintail, Ross, Ross And Cromarty, Scotland

Death Date: 15 MAY 1593

Death Location: Priory Beauly, Inverness, Scotland

Father: Colin, McKenzie

Mother: Barbara, Grant

Spouse(s): Simon, Fraser

Children(s): Margaret Fraser, Hugh, Fraser

Katherine McKenzie was born in 1574 in Kintail, Ross, Ross And Cromarty, Scotland, the child of Colin Cam One Eyed 11Th Of Kintail Chief Of Clan Mckenzie And Barbara Of Freuchie Grant. Katherine McKenzie married Simon 6Th Lord Lovat Fraser, and had children including Hugh 7Th Lord Lovat Fraser, Margaret Fraser. Katherine McKenzie passed away in 1593 in Priory Beauly, Inverness, Scotland.
